Long gun registry failed

The tragedy in Alberta with the death of four young RCMP officers leads me to question how C-68 and the long gun registry failed so miserably.

After this government spent more than a billion dollars on the registry, Canadians deserve value for their money.

I am asking that Auditor General Sheila Fraser do an intensive audit on all money spent on the creation and maintenance of the long-gun registry to
answer the question, "Have Canadian taxpayers received value for their spent tax dollars?"

And, the spending continues with the government budgeting $85 million for the registry this year.

The time for accountability is long overdue.

Inky Mark, MP, Dauphin-Swan River-Marquette
